Does OnPoint require a provider visit?

COVID Testing at all OnPoint sites must include a provider visit for us to comply with malpractice regulations and our insurance company contracts. After you consult our provider, the test samples are collected and sent to third-party laboratories; you may receive a separate bill from them if your insurance deductible hasn’t been met.

Can you walk in to urgent care for PCR?

If you are without symptoms you may walk-in to any of our sites. If you have symptoms we ask that you register online and we will contact you about how to proceed.

Does OnPoint Urgent Care have the same electronic records?

At OnPoint Urgent Care, we can schedule a follow-up with a Primary Care, OB/Gyn, or Pediatric provider before you check-out! On top of that, all of our Urgent Care and Primary Care practices are on the same Electronic Medical Records system, Athena. Meaning you will not waste time filling out unnecessary duplicate paperwork!

How much does an emergency room visit cost?

What To Do: After Hours Emergencies 1 The average cost of a hospital ER visit or Freestanding Emergency Room visit: $1,500 2 The Average cost of an Urgent Care visit typically ranges from: $30-$150, Depending on your copay and deductible.

What is a free standing emergency room?

Free-Standing Emergency Rooms look like an urgent care clinic, but they will cost the same as an ER visit at the hospital! When in doubt call first and ask if they are an Urgent Care or an Emergency Room.
